Branded apparel for a brand-conscious market

Scottsdale customers tend to care more than most about how the finished piece looks, and that changes what we recommend. Embroidery does most of the work here — a stitched left-chest logo on a good polo or quarter-zip reads as premium in a way a print doesn't, and it holds up for years.

Garment choice matters just as much as decoration. A logo stitched onto a cheap blank still looks like a cheap blank. We'll usually suggest spending a little more on the piece itself and keeping the decoration understated, which is the opposite of what people expect us to say.

What decoration looks best on premium apparel?
Embroidery, in most cases. A stitched logo on a good polo or quarter-zip reads as more established than a print and lasts for years without cracking. For tees and full-color artwork, printing is still the better and cheaper choice.
Can you do small runs for client gifts?
Yes. DTF starts at 12 pieces and embroidery at 24, and through an online store there's no minimum at all. For gifting we'll usually suggest spending more on the garment and keeping the branding understated — it gets kept and worn far more often.
